شبیه سازی مفاهیم مخابراتی در متلب
نرم افزار متلب
متلب، یک زبان برنامه نویسی قدرتمند و محیط نرم افزاری، قابلیت ها و مزایای متعددی را برای صنعت مخابرات ارائه می دهد:
پردازش سیگنال: متلب مجموعه جامعی از ابزارها و کتابخانه های پردازش سیگنال را ارائه می دهد که آن را برای توسعه و پیاده سازی الگوریتم هایی برای مدولاسیون سیگنال، دمدولاسیون، رمزگذاری، رمزگشایی و فیلتر در سیستم های ارتباطی ایده آل می کند.
ارتباطات بی سیم: متلب شامل جعبه ابزارهای تخصصی برای ارتباطات بی سیم است، مانند جعبه ابزار ارتباطات، که توابع و الگوریتم هایی را برای طراحی، شبیه سازی و آزمایش سیستم های ارتباطی بی سیم، از جمله LTE، 5G، WLAN و بلوتوث ارائه می دهد.
مدلسازی کانال: متلب مدلسازی و شبیهسازی کانالهای ارتباطی، از جمله کانالهای محو، انتشار چند مسیری و اثرات تداخل را امکانپذیر میکند و به مهندسان مخابرات اجازه میدهد تا عملکرد سیستم را ارزیابی کرده و پارامترهایی مانند کدگذاری کانال و یکسان سازی را بهینه کنند.
طراحی آنتن: متلب ابزارهایی را برای طراحی و تجزیه و تحلیل آنتن فراهم می کند که مهندسان را قادر می سازد تا آرایه های آنتن را طراحی و بهینه کنند، الگوهای تشعشع را محاسبه کنند و عملکرد آنتن را در شرایط کاری و محیط های مختلف ارزیابی کنند.
شبیه سازی و نمونه سازی: قابلیت های شبیه سازی متلب به مهندسان مخابرات اجازه می دهد تا کل سیستم های ارتباطی، از پردازش سیگنال لایه فیزیکی گرفته تا تعاملات پروتکل های سطح بالاتر، طراحی، تست و تایید سیستم را قبل از اجرای سخت افزار، مدل سازی و شبیه سازی کنند.
توسعه الگوریتم: نحو بصری و کتابخانه گسترده توابع ریاضی و عددی متلب آن را برای توسعه و نمونهسازی الگوریتمهای ارتباطی، مانند کدگذاری تصحیح خطا، طرحهای مدولاسیون، و تکنیکهای یکسانسازی مناسب میسازد.
نمایش داده ها: متلب قابلیت های نمایش داده های قدرتمندی را ارائه می دهد که به مهندسان امکان نمایش و تجزیه و تحلیل نتایج شبیه سازی، معیارهای عملکرد سیستم و شکل موج سیگنال را می دهد و بینش و تصمیم گیری در طراحی و بهینه سازی سیستم را تسهیل می کند.
قابلیت همکاری: متلب از قابلیت همکاری با سایر زبانهای برنامهنویسی و ابزارهای نرمافزاری که معمولاً در صنعت ارتباطات از راه دور استفاده میشوند، مانند C/C++، Python و Simulink پشتیبانی میکند.